Api-ms-win-core-synch-l1-2-0.dll ファイルは Microsoft によって公開されていますが、デフォルトの Windows 10 インストールには含まれていません。これは、特定の状況でユーザーがこのファイルが欠落している問題に直面する可能性があることを意味します。
DLL ファイルが失われると、複数のアプリケーションが正常に起動しないことがあります。この状況では、エラーメッセージが表示され、ユーザーは「api-ms-win-core-synch-11-2-0.dll ファイルが見つかりません」といった通知を目にすることがあります。この問題は単一のプログラムにとどまらず、その DLL ファイルに依存する他のアプリケーションにも影響を及ぼし、より広範な機能障害を引き起こす可能性があります。
この問題を解決するために、ユーザーは「api-ms-win-core-synch-l1-2-0.dll ファイルが見つかりません」というエラーを修正するために、以下の8つの方法を参照することができます。
api-ms-win-core-synch-l1-2-0.dll とは何ですか?
api-ms-win-core-synch-11-2-0.dll は、Windows 10オペレーティングシステムに属する重要な動的リンクライブラリ(DLL)ファイルで、マルチスレッドアプリケーションのスレッド同期機能をサポートするために特化しています。このファイルは、複数のスレッドがファイルやメモリ領域などのリソースを安全に共有し、アクセスできるようにするためのツールやメカニズムを提供し、データの競合や競争状態を防ぎます。この DLL ファイルが欠如しているか、破損している場合、ユーザーはこのファイルに依存するプログラムを実行しようとするとエラーメッセージに直面し、アプリケーションが起動できなくなったり正常に動作しなくなったりする可能性があります。
api-ms-win-core-synch-l1-2-0.dll エラー
api-ms-win-core-synch-l1-2-0.dll エラーが発生すると、ユーザーはアプリケーションが起動できない、またはシステムが不安定になるといった問題に直面することがあります。これらの症状は、他のアプリケーションがクラッシュしたり、動作が遅くなったりする原因となり、システム全体のパフォーマンスに影響を与えます。
このエラーは主にいくつかの要因によって引き起こされます。まず、ファイルが誤って削除されたり移動されたりすることがあり、これは通常、ユーザーが手動でシステムファイルを整理したり、互換性のないソフトウェアをインストールした際に発生します。次に、ファイルの破損も一般的な原因であり、ウイルス感染やシステムのクラッシュ、ハードディスクの故障によって破損することがあります。さらに、特定のアプリケーションバージョンが現在の Windows 10システムと互換性がない場合、プログラムが実行時に DLL ファイルを見つけられず、読み込むことができなくなります。これらのすべての状況が、関連するアプリケーションが正常に起動し、動作することを妨げます。api-ms-win-core-synch-l1-2-0.dll エラーが発生した際、ユーザーは以下のようなエラーメッセージのいずれかを受け取ることになります。
- api-ms-win-core-synch-l1-2-0.dll が見つかりません。
- api-ms-win-core-synch-l1-2-0.dll が破損しています。
- api-ms-win-core-synch-l1-2-0.dll のロードに失敗しました。
- このアプリケーションを実行するには api-ms-win-core-synch-l1-2-0.dll が必要です。
- コンピューターにapi-ms-win-core-synch-l1-2-0.dllがないため、プログラムを開始できません。この問題を解決するには、プログラムを再インストールしてみてください。
api-ms-win-core-synch-l1-2-0.dll が欠落した場合、次の手順を試してみてください。
api-ms-win-core-synch-l1-2-0.dll が欠落した場合、どうすればよいですか?
方法 1: PCを再起動する
コンピュータを再起動すると、一時ファイルがクリアされ、システムプロセスがリセットされるため、api-ms-win-core-synch-l1-2-0.dllエラーが解決することがあります。作業を保存してアプリを閉じた後、スタートメニューから電源ボタンを選び「再起動」をクリックしてください。再起動後にエラーが解消されているか確認します。
方法2: アプリケーションの再インストール
アプリケーションのインストールパッケージには、通常すべての必要な DLL ファイルが含まれています。再インストールを行うと、欠落している api-ms-win-core-synch-l1-2-0.dll ファイルがシステムに再コピーされます。DLL ファイルが破損している場合、再インストールによってインストールパッケージ内の正常なバージョンで破損したファイルが置き換えられ、このことでファイルの破損によるエラーが解消されます。さらに、インストール中にアプリケーションがそのコンポーネントを再登録することがあり、これにより不正確なレジストリ項目に起因する問題が修正される可能性があります。これらの方法によって、再インストールは問題のあるアプリケーションの正常な機能を回復し、関連する DLL エラーを解決するのに役立ちます。
- Windowsを開き、「コントロールパネル」を選択します。
- 「プログラムのアンインストール」をクリックします。
- 対象のプログラムを見つけて選択し、「アンインストール」をクリックします。
- コンピュータと互換性のある更新プログラムをインストールする前に、「再起動」を選択してプログラムが完全にアンインストールされたか確認します。
- コンピュータを再起動し、プログラムが正常に動作するかをテストします。
方法3: DLL 修復ツールを実行する
サードパーティの DLL 修復アシスタントは、システムをスキャンして欠落または破損した api-ms-win-core-synch-l1-2-0.dll ファイルを検出し、データベースから正しいバージョンを自動的にダウンロードして置き換えます。さらに、DLL ファイルに関連するレジストリ項目をチェックし、修正することでシステムの正常な動作を確保します。これらのステップを通じて、修復アシスタントは DLL ファイルの問題によって引き起こされるエラーを効果的に解決し、システムの安定性とパフォーマンスを向上させることができます。
Bitwar DLL Fixerソフトウェアの利点:
- 簡単なクリックで破損、損傷、または失われた DLL ファイルを修復または置換できます。
- 失われた DirectX ファイルとランタイムライブラリを復元します。
- 高い成功率と無料の技術サポートを提供します。
- 技術的な知識や手動での調整は不要です。
- コンピュータを迅速にスキャンし、プログラムの不具合を引き起こす DLL エラーを特定します。
- Windows プログラムやゲームの起動問題を迅速に修正します。
Bitwar DLL Fixer公式サイト:https://www.bitwarsoft.com/ja/dll-fixer
Bitwar DLL Fixerソフト無料ダウンロード/インストール:
Bitwar DLL Fixer を使用して DLL ファイルを修復する手順
- Bitwar DLL Fixer をダウンロードして起動します。 左側のパネルから「全体修正」を選択します。
- 「スキャン開始」をクリックします。 スキャンが完了するまで待機し、リストに表示された DLL ファイルを確認した後、「修復」ボタンをクリックして該当する DLL ファイルを修復します。
- 修復が完了すると、画面に通知が表示されます。その後、DLL ファイルの問題が解消されたかを確認するため、関連するプログラムを起動してください。
注意: 修復したいapi-ms-win-core-synch-l1-2-0.dllファイルが「全体修正」や「システムDLL修復」でdll見つからない場合は、手動修復を試みることができます。
手動修復手順:
- 「手動修復」をクリックし、DLLの名前と保存先パスを入力します。
- その後、「スキャン開始」をクリックします。次に、コンピュータに適したバージョンを選択し、「修復」をクリックしてください。
- 修復が完了したら、必ずコンピュータを再起動することをお勧めします。これにより、修復が正しく反映され、システムが安定して動作するようになります。
方法4: Api-ms-win-core-synch-l1-2-0.dllの手動ダウンロード
手動で api-ms-win-core-synch-l1-2-0.dll ファイルをダウンロードしてインストールすることで、DLLが見つからないエラーに対処できるかもしれませんが、自分でDLLファイルを置き換えることは推奨されません。これは多くのトラブルを引き起こす可能性があるからです。特に、DLLファイルなどのシステムファイルを配布すると主張するサイトには、誤解を招く情報が含まれていることが多く、マルウェアや他の危険なファイルが混在していることがあります。
以下の手順に従って、dll無料ダウンロードしてください:
- 欠如しているapi-ms-win-core-synch-l1-2-0.dllファイルの最新バージョンをダウンロードします。
- api-ms-win-core-synch-l1-2-0.dllファイル ダウンロードしたら、次の場所に移動します – C:\Windows。
- ここで、System32フォルダーとSysWOW64フォルダーを見つけます。
- 32ビットのWindows OSを使用している場合、SysWOW64フォルダーは見つかりません。この場合は、32ビットのapi-ms-win-core-synch-l1-2-0.dllファイルをコピーしてSystem32フォルダーに貼り付けます。ただし、64ビットのWindows OSを使用している場合は、32ビットのapi-ms-win-core-synch-l1-2-0.dllファイルをSystem32フォルダーに、64ビットのapi-ms-win-core-synch-l1-2-0.dllファイルをSysWOW64フォルダーにコピーします。
- Windows + Sキーを押して検索を開き、「cmd」と入力し、コマンドプロンプトを管理者として実行します。
- 「regsvr32 api-ms-win-core-synch-l1-2-0.dll」と入力し、Enterキーを押します、DLLが登録されているか確認します。必要であれば、手動でエントリを追加します。
- すべてを閉じて、コンピュータを再起動します。これで「api-ms-win-core-synch-l1-2-0.dll見つから ない」というエラーメッセージが解決されるはずです。
方法5:Microsoft Visual C++ 再配布可能パッケージをダウンロードする
Microsoft Visual C++ Redistributablesをダウンロードすることで、api-ms-win-core-synch-l1-2-0.dllのエラーを修正できます。このエラーは通常、欠損または不適切なVisual C++ランタイムライブラリに関連しています。これらのランタイムライブラリは、多くのプログラムに必要な基本機能や共有DLLファイルを提供しており、インストールまたは再インストールすることで、必要なファイルが正しくインストールされ、ファイルの破損や欠損による問題を解決できます。さらに、適切なバージョンに更新することで、バージョンの不整合によるエラーを回避することも可能です。
- 「スタート」を右クリックし、 「 設定 」>「 システム 」 >「 バージョン情報 」をクリックします。
- システムの種類(32ビットまたは64ビット)を確認します。
- MicrosoftのVisual C++ダウンロードページに移動し、各バージョンの再頒布可能パッケージをダウンロードします。
- dll ダウンロードしたファイルを開き、コンピュータにインストールします。すでにインストールされている場合は、「修復」オプションを選択して、既存のインストールを修正します。修復がうまくいかない場合は、まず古いバージョンをアンインストールし、その後最新バージョンを再インストールします。
- コンピュータを再起動し、エラーが修正されたか確認します。
方法6:SFCおよびDISMコマンドを実行する
SFC(システムファイルチェッカー)とDISM(展開イメージサービスと管理)ツールを使用することで、api-ms-win-core-synch-l1-2-0.dllのエラーを修正できます。これらのツールは、Windowsシステム内の破損または欠損したシステムファイルをスキャンして修復する機能を持っています。sfcは保護されたシステムファイルをチェックし、破損または欠損しているファイルを置き換えます。一方、dismはWindowsイメージを修復し、システムコンポーネントの整合性を確保します。これらのツールを実行することで、ユーザーはシステムファイルの問題によって引き起こされるDLLエラーを効果的に解決し、プログラムの正常な動作を回復できます。
- 管理者としてコマンドプロンプトを実行します。
- コマンドウィンドウに「sfc /scannow」と入力し、Enterを押します。
- プロセスが完了したら、以下のコマンドを実行します:
DISM /Online /Cleanup-Image /RestoreHealth
作業が完了したら、コンピュータを再起動し、アプリを再起動して、DLLが見つからない問題が解決されたかどうかを確認してください。
方法7: Windowsシステムの更新
システム更新は、api-ms-win-core-synch-l1-2-0.dllのエラーを修正できます。更新にはオペレーティングシステムや関連コンポーネントの修正が含まれており、破損または欠損したDLLファイルを置き換えることで、システムの整合性と互換性を確保します。これにより、ファイルの不一致によるDLLエラーを解決し、プログラムの正常な動作を回復できます。
以下はWindowsシステムを更新する手順です:
- まず、キーボードの「Windows」キーと「I」キーを同時に押して、Windowsの設定メニューを表示させます。
- 次に、設定メニューから「更新とセキュリティ」を選択します。このセクションでは、Windowsの更新やセキュリティに関連するオプションがまとめられています。その後、「Windows Update」の項目に進み、「更新プログラムのチェック」をクリックしましょう。
- もし新しいWindowsアップデートが利用可能な場合は、「今すぐインストール」ボタンが表示されます。それをクリックし、画面に表示される指示に従って、最新のアップデートをインストールしてください。このプロセスが完了すると、システムが最新の状態になります。
方法8:システムの復元を実行
システムの復元は、api-ms-win-core-synch-l1-2-0.dllのエラーを修正できます。なぜなら、システムの状態を以前の時点に戻すことで、その時点には完全で破損していないシステムファイルや設定が含まれている可能性があるからです。DLLファイルなどのシステムファイルが破損または欠損した場合、システムの復元を実行することで、エラーが発生する前の状態に戻し、ファイルの問題によるエラーを解決できます。この方法は、問題を引き起こす変更を効果的に排除し、関連するプログラムが正常に動作することを保証します。
具体的な手順を見ていきましょう:
- Windowsの検索バーに「システムの復元ポイントの作成」と入力し、Enterキーを押します。
- 「システムの保護」>「システムの復元」をクリックします。
- 「別の復元ポイントを選択」を選び(利用可能な場合)、次へ進みます。
- 「より多くの復元ポイントを表示する」チェックボックスにチェックを入れます。
- 問題が発生する前の日付を選択します。
- 次へ進み、必要に応じてシステムを再起動します。
結論
Windows 10のオペレーティングシステムにおいて、スレッドとプロセスの調整を担う重要なシステムファイルがapi-ms-win-core-synch-l1-2-0.dllです。このファイルが欠如すると、このDLLに依存するプログラムが起動できなくなったり、動作しなくなったりします。また、システムの不安定やパフォーマンスの問題も引き起こされる可能性があります。そのため、api-ms-win-core-synch-l1-2-0.dllの欠損問題を放置することはできません。本記事では、この問題を修正するための8つの方法を推奨していますので、ぜひじっくりとお読みいただき、自分に合った方法を慎重に選んでください。